A social media account affiliated with Israel’s Mossad intelligence agency published a pointed critique Friday of Iranian Supreme Leader Ayatollah Ali Khamenei, accusing him of being unfit to govern due to alleged substance abuse and detachment from public needs.
“How can a leader lead when they sleep half the day and spend the other half high on substances?” read the post in Farsi from the @MossadSpokesman account on X, formerly Twitter. It ended with a charged refrain: “Water, electricity, life!”
The post, which was automatically translated from its original Farsi, did not name Khamenei directly but was widely interpreted as referring to the 86-year-old supreme leader. The @MossadSpokesman account, verified and often used to deliver messages targeting the Iranian regime, frequently engages Farsi-speaking audiences with political messaging critical of Tehran’s leadership.
